Campus Description and Transportation Services
- Description:
 
 - 600-acre campus in Big Rapids (population: 14,600), 50 miles from Grand
 
- Rapids; branch campus in Grand Rapids. Served by bus; airport and train
 
- serve Grand Rapids. Public transportation serves campus.
    
  
Housing
Types of Housing
 
- Coed Dorms.
 - Women's Dorms.
 - Fraternity housing.
 - School-owned/operated Apartments.
 - On-campus Married-student housing.
 - Other:
 Private rooms.
 - 46% of all students live in school housing of some type.
  
Students who are required to live on campus:
- 
All freshmen and sophomores must live on campus.
  
Campus housing is available for all unmarried students regardless of year.
The school provides assistance in locating off-campus housing if on-campus housing is not available.
  
Campus Rules, Regulations & Policies
 
- All students may have cars on campus.
 - 68% of all students have cars on campus.
 - Alcohol is not permitted on campus, even to those students of legal drinking age.
  
Other Policies
 
- Class attendance policies set by individual instructors
 - Hazing Prohibited
  
  
Student Employment
 
- 32% of full-time undergraduates work on campus during the year.
 - Undergraduates may expect to earn, on average, $1600 per year working part-time on campus.
 - This school participates in College Work/Study Program.
 - Institutional employment is available.
 - Part-time off-campus employment opportunities are good.
 - Freshmen are not discouraged from working during first term.
